Padham's Green is a hamlet in the Brentwood district, in the English county of Essex. It is near the town of Ingatestone. It is assumed to be a manorial name, deriving from the family of William de Perham. Padham’s Green is situated 3 miles southwest of Margaretting Church of England Voluntary Controlled Primary School.
